Three suspects have been arrested in connection with a burglary that took place at the home of Cleveland Browns quarterback Shedeur Sanders, the Medina County Sheriff's Office said Wednesday. The three individuals who broke into Sanders' home Nov. 16, as well as the driver of the vehicle involved, have been identified, according to a news release. The fourth suspect is at large with an active warrant for his arrest, according to the release, which also stated that the investigation has been completed.
